-----BEGIN PGP SIGNED MESSAGE----- Hash: SHA1 I just replied, but I want to be abit more specific. PostgresqlDataSource provides methods to set database servername, etc. I want my pooled datasource to have those as well. But having a configuration file that can read default connections is useful in certain cases. I want to be able to retrieve the info from JNDI namespace eventually, but a properties file that contains the info is useful outside of JNDI environments.
